The R.D. Murray Company was a Hamburg, New York fire apparatus manufacturer founded by Ronald D. Murray in 1973. The initially company made its mark refurbishing fire apparatus and moved into the manufacture of complete fire apparatus in the early 1990s. In 1998, R.D. Murray was purchased by American LaFrance and built pumper and rescue bodies. The plant was closed in 2008 or 2009 as ALF ran into financial difficulty. A former owner purchased the plant and entered into an agreement with E-One Inc. and now builds stainless-steel bodies for the Florida manufacturer.
